Backend Engineer in SAP Sustainability Data Exchange

As a Backend Engineer within the Sustainability Data Exchange (SDX) team, you will take ownership of the technical architecture that allows businesses to share critical environmental data. You will spend your days building and maintaining robust APIs, event-driven microservices, and AI-enabled features using Java and Spring Boot. This role moves beyond pure coding to involve the design of data processing pipelines that handle complex multi-tenant supply chain models.

This position is at the heart of the global decarbonization effort. By developing the SDX platform, you are enabling thousands of companies to exchange standardized Scope 3 product footprint information, which is traditionally the hardest data to capture. Your work provides the transparency needed for global value chains to move from vague estimates to actual, actionable carbon data, facilitating real environmental accountability across industries.

This suits someone who has a strong software engineering foundation and is eager to apply their backend skills to solve the planet’s most pressing data transparency problems.

What aspects of the company's sustainability is this role likely to focus on?

This role focuses specifically on decarbonization of the value chain. While many sustainability roles look at internal operations, this position builds the tools for external transparency. You will be working on features that allow companies to request and share Product Footprint information, which is a core part of addressing climate change at scale. By ensuring that sustainability data is standardized and reliable, you help eliminate the 'greenwashing' risks associated with estimated data. Your work supports global initiatives like the WBCSD, directly impacting how global commerce accounts for its environmental footprint through software-driven collaboration.

What are the main challenges someone in this role might face?

One of the main challenges will be managing the complexity of multi-tenant data models in a supply chain context. Ensuring that data remains secure and private while being easily shareable between business partners requires a sophisticated approach to backend architecture. You may also face technical hurdles related to system migration as the team moves towards SAP HANA. Additionally, integrating AI into production-grade enterprise software brings unique challenges around reliability and performance tuning. You will need to balance the rapid pace of AI innovation with the high stability requirements of a global platform like SDX.
